All children love music, love to dance and love to make noise.  Why not help them have fun while improving their coordination, music recognition and self esteem.  Plus it gives them a chance to make their own instruments, using their imagination.



You can be make drums out of tin cans, pots, or pans.  You can use sticks directly on them to make the noise or put a rubber ballon over the top and fasten very tightly with an elastic or tape.


You can use bells or tin cans as maraca's.  Simple take an empty can (ones with plastic lids are excellent) and place beans, beads, or anything small inside to make the noise.  Seal the can tightly and decorate the outside with markers, paint, beads, stickers.  Remember with younger children to make sure that the lid is sealed very well so there is nothing for them to choke on.


You can use paper towel tubs, rolled paper and decorate them to make a trumpet or horn.  You can also use whistles or party noise makers.


Just look around your home, there are many wonderful things that would make great instruments with very little work.  Then you just stand back and see the joy and happiness on your children's faces.  The most important part is that the children use their imagination and have FUN!!!!
